If you're looking for a solid restoration project TR-6 this is definitely it! This car is unbelievably rust free and solid. It is a 1969 model which is the first year for the TR-6. It has a few nice features not found on later models including: no ugly over rider bumpers, no obnoxious steering lock and ignition switch under the dash by your knees. The Ignition switch is on the center console like a TR-4. some of the interior trim and exterior details are also particular to 1969. The original owner passed away and the car sat un-driven since the late 1980's. As you will see from the video posted below, I did get the engine started and it runs amazingly well! It has fantastic oil pressure and does not have excessive crankshaft end play (A common TR-6 problem). The Fuel system will need a thorough cleaning I ran it by simply filling each carburetors float bowl. The Fuel tank does not look rusty just has old, bad fuel in it. The brake and clutch hydraulics will of course need to be gone through although amazingly the brakes actually work a little bit. The electrical charging system works. most of the instruments work.Because the clutch hydraulics don't work the clutch and gearbox are untested but it does shift through gears o.k. when not running..It does not have an overdrive unit. This car would have come with Stromberg carburetors and some one has changed to S.U.'s (an improvement) otherwise the engine looks to be completely original and is the original engine for this car.
